“…Among optimization algorithms, a genetic algorithm (GA) has advantage that it is insensitive to initial value and it is possible to search the global minimum value. In petroleum engineering, Sung et al 1 had examined applicability and validity of GA as a optimization algorithm for inverse calculation, and Kwon et al 2 had developed 3D reservoir characterization model using GA, and they successfully performed models to the characterization of heterogeneous reservoir. Romero et al 3,4 had also developed a reservoir characterization model using GA and applied it successfully to the actual field.…”
